Cariboo Road

0.0 (0)

Set against the early days of the Cariboo Gold Rush in British Columbia, the book follows the fortunes of the American-born Bowers family, and the friends and enemies they meet in the Cariboo. Several genuinely historical figures, such as Billy Barker and Judge Begbie, figure as characters in the book. A lively adventure story with a fairly authentic historical background.
